
Haiti Prime minister lands in Kenya for a 4 day state visit

Acting Haitian Prime Minister Garry Conille has landed in Kenya for a four-day state visit.
Prime Cabinet Secretary Musalia Mudavadi who is also the foreign affairs Cabinet Secretary welcomed Conille at the Jomo Kenyatta International Airport (JKIA) on Thursday.
According to Mudavadi, Conille is expected to hold high-level bilateral talks with President William Ruto surrounding strengthening security cooperation and fostering partnerships that promote regional stability between Kenya and Haiti.
“This visit by H.E. Dr. Conille represents a significant moment in the deepening of diplomatic relations between our two countries, with both Kenya and Haiti eager to explore new avenues for collaboration in economic development and security partnerships,” Mudavadi stated.
The CS was accompanied by his Labour and Social Protection counterpart Dr Alfred Mutua, National Security Advisor, Dr. Monica Juma and Butere MP Tindi Mwale.
The visit by the Haitian prime minister comes days after the Caribbean nation's apparent massacre northwest of Port-au-Prince that left at least 70 people dead.
The attack, carried out early Thursday in the town of Pont Sonde, some 100 kilometres (60 miles) from the capital, also saw scores of houses and vehicles torched after gang members opened fire.
